In Okinawa, “parlor” means a store that serves light meals. It never means a pachinko parlor. Elderly people in Okinawa call a pachinko parlor as “machine shop.” Okinawa was once ruled by the United States. Since American culture has taken root in Okinawa, slot machines have been the mainstream of gambling. I remember Okinawa is the highest in Japan that the population ratio of the number of pachinko parlors. Because there is no public gambling in Okinawa.

Okinawa soba noodles are not buckwheat noodles. It’s neither udon nor ramen. Okinawan noodles made from wheat flour, salt, water and wood ash. And yakisoba also uses Okinawan soba noodles. There are salty, sauce and ketchup flavors for yakisoba. The dish called “Napolitan” in Okinawa used to be fried Okinawa soba noodles and vegetables and seasoned with ketchup. Mainland Japan’s Napolitan uses pasta. Neither exists in Italy. It is a dish created by the Japanese in the image of Italy.
